I heard this one the other day, anyone got a good explanation for this?


3 men stay at a hotel that costs $25 per night. The front desk accidentally charges the men $30 for the room ($10 per person). The front desk clerk feels bad, so he gives the bellboy $5 and says to split it between the men. The bellboy gives each man $1 back and pockets $2.

Each man payed $10 initially.
Bellboy gave back $1 to each

10-1= 9
each man payed $9 for the room

9 * 3 = 27
27 + 2(in the bellboy's pocket) = 29

Where is the other dollar?

The problem is that you are changing the premise halfway through it.  They paid $30 for the rooms.  The $5 back means they paid $25 for the rooms as a whole.  They got back $3 and the bellboy kept $2.  $25 + $3 +$2 = $30.

There is no missing dollar
$25 in the hotel's till
$3 in their pockets
$2 in the bellhop's pocket
